(1) The Department of Juvenile Justice shall have the sole authority and responsibility for establishing the design of the juvenile sexual offender treatment program but shall consult with the Administrative Office of the Courts and the Cabinet for Health and Family Services.
(2) The Department of Juvenile Justice may enter into agreements with public or private agencies in order to implement and operate the juvenile sexual offender treatment program.
